Frozen Poultry Specs: What to Know About Standards
When purchasing frozen chicken, it's essential to understand the specifications that ensure quality and safety. These specifications outline various aspects of the product, from its proximity to processing methods and packaging standards. Regulations set by governing bodies like the USDA provide a framework for these specifications, ensuring consumers receive safe and dependable poultry products.
Key specifications include factors such as breed, weight range, and preparation.
- Furthermore, standards address the handling and storage practices employed throughout the production chain to minimize the risk of contamination.
- Examine for labels that indicate compliance with established quality assurance programs, such as HACCP (Hazard Analysis and Critical Control Points).
By understanding these specifications, you can make informed choices about frozen chicken acquisitions and ensure you are getting a safe and high-quality product.
